Backpacking 101: What You Need in Your Pack

Embarking on your inaugural backpacking adventure is an exciting prospect! But before you hit the trail, it's crucial to gather the essential gear that will make your trip both enjoyable and safe. This list won't tax your pack, but it'll ensure you're prepared for anything Mother Nature dishes out.

  • A sturdy backpack: This is the cornerstone of your setup. Choose a size that accommodates your needs and make sure it's comfortable.
  • Durable sleeping bag: Opt for one rated for the expected temperatures, as a warm night's sleep is crucial.
  • A lightweight campsite haven: A reliable shelter will provide protection from the elements and give you a sense of security.
  • Meal-making tools: Consider your menu needs when choosing your cooking setup.

Remember, this is just a starting point. Adapt your packing list based on the specific demands of your expedition. Happy trails!

Hitting the Trail: Navigating Your First Backpacking Trip

Embarking upon your first backpacking adventure can be both exhilarating and daunting. Packing the suitable gear, mastering essential skills, and preparing a safe and enjoyable route are all crucial stages. Before you hit out onto the trail, consider these tips to ensure a smooth experience.

  • Explore your chosen trail thoroughly, considering its extent, elevation gain, and difficulty.
  • Gather lightweight and durable gear, prioritizing items that are necessary for your survival in the wilderness.
  • Learn about basic backcountry skills using a map and compass, and explore downloading offline maps for your phone.
  • Refine essential skills like setting up your tent, treating water, and constructing a basic fire before you go.
  • Practice responsible outdoor ethics by packing out all trash, staying on designated trails, and being mindful of wildlife.

Embrace the experience of connecting with nature and pushing your limits. With careful planning and preparation, your first backpacking trip can be an unforgettable journey.

Practice Responsible Hiking: Responsible Backpacking in the USA

Embarking on a backpacking adventure through America's stunning landscapes offers unforgettable moments. However, it's crucial to prioritize Leave No Trace principles to guarantee the natural beauty of these areas for generations to come. Adhere to these guidelines by effectively packing out all your trash, remaining on designated trails, and minimizing campfire impacts. Remember, every backpacker has a obligation to preserve the environment and leave a meaningful impact.

  • Research thoroughly: Understand the area's regulations, weather conditions, and potential hazards.
